As per EN 60204-1, the device is intended for installation in
control cabinets with a minimum degree of protection of
IP54. It is mounted on a 35-mm DIN rail according to DIN
EN 60715 TH35.

Correct Use

The ESM-TE3.. is an expansion module that can be operated with
any basic device from the EUCHNER ESM series, e.g. ESM-BA2.. or
ESM-BA3.., in order to permit delayed switch-off of machine
parts. This could be the case if it is safer to return a tool to its
initial position first instead of stopping operation immediately,
for example. The ESM-TE3.. was developed as a component for a
modular system.

Any combination of ESM-TE3 units and non-time-delayed ESM-
ES3.. expansion blocks can be interconnected with just a few
lines, permitting realization of an overall system with different
times and the specific number of safety contacts required.

Features

3 safe, redundant, time-delayed relay outputs
1 auxiliary contact (fault monitoring)

Activation via basic device from the EUCHNER ESM
series

Continuously adjustable delay, 1 to 30s or fixed time
delay (ESM-TE3..-05S)

Function

The time-delayed emergency stop safety switching device
ESM-TE3.. in combination with a basic device from the
EUCHNER ESM series is designed for safe isolation of
safety circuits according to EN 60204-1 and can be used
up to safety category 3, PL d according to EN ISO 13849-1.
The ESM-TE3.. provides a control voltage of DC 24V at
terminal S11. In order for the ESM-TE3.. to switch together
with the connected basic device, the control voltage at S11
is connected to terminals S15 and S16 of the ESM-TE3..
via one of the safety contacts of the basic device (see
Wiring section on page 2).
The safety contacts of the basic device close when the
basic device is activated, and the DC 24V control voltage at
terminal S11 is then connected with terminals S15 and S16
of the ESM-TE3... The safety contacts of the ESM-TE3..
switch immediately.
The basic device disconnects the control voltage when the
safety switch is operated, and the safety contacts of the
ESM-TE3.. open after the time set on the ESM-TE3..
elapses (the power supply must be present during the time
sequence).

When the 24 V version is used, a safety transformer
according to EN 61558-2-6 or a power supply unit with
electrical isolation from the mains must be connected.

External fusing of the safety contacts (4 A slow-blow or 6
A quick-action or 10 A gG) must be provided.

A maximum length of the control lines of 1000 meters
with a line cross section of 0.75 mm

2

must not be ex-

ceeded.

The line cross section must not exceed 2.5 mm

2

.

If the device does not function after commissioning, it
must be returned to the manufacturer unopened. Open-
ing the device will void the warranty.

Installation

Safety
Precautions

Installation and commissioning of the device must be
performed only by authorized personnel.

Observe the country-specific regulations when installing
the device.

The electrical connection of the device is only allowed to
be made with the device isolated.

The wiring of the device must comply with the instruc-
tions in this user information, otherwise there is a risk
that the safety function will be lost.
